Delaware State earned a convincing 36-14 win over Bowie State in this HBCU showdown, but Head Coach DeSean Jackson called it a “bittersweet” victory.
Quarterback Kaiden Bennett threw for 179 yards and 2 touchdowns while rushing for another score. Phillippe Wesley added a 64-yard TD reception, and NyGhee Lolley ripped off a 58-yard touchdown run. On defense, Jadarrius Perkins recorded a safety and a fumble recovery, with big plays from Na’Shawn Biggs and Allen Smith.
Bowie State fought behind Micah Robinson’s 92 rushing yards and 52-yard breakaway, but penalties stalled the Bulldogs’ momentum.
Coach Jackson’s postgame message? The scoreboard isn’t the standard — discipline is. The Hornets move forward in what fans are calling a “new era” of Delaware State football.
📌 Final Score: Delaware State 36, Bowie State 14
